Gandhinagar, May 15 (IANS) The Gujarat State Yog Board will organise around 225 summer yoga camps for children aged between seven and 15 across cities, talukas and villages in the state from May 16 to May 30, as part of a statewide initiative aimed at encouraging healthier lifestyles and reducing excessive screen exposure among children during the summer vacation period.The “Summer Yoga Camp-2026” is being organised in connection with the observance of ‘International Yoga Day’ and will focus…
